**Mgmt Meeting Minutes — Retiring the Brightline Range**

Quick recap for sales leads at Fenholt Supplies: we agreed to retire the Brightline fixture range by year-end. Remaining stock moves to clearance pricing next month, and accounts on standing orders get migrated to the Lumetta range. Trade-in incentives were approved in principle. The confidential note on next steps sits just below.

board note of bajof-bajeg: The pricing group signed off on a budget of $13.4 million for Project Sildor. The renewal with Lamixek Holdings closes at $48.9 million a year, 49 percent above the last contract.

TICKET-4417: Expired creds blocking date-format localization

Quick one for the sync: the Lunareal localization job that converts date formats for the Tarwick market rollout has been failing since Tuesday. Root cause: the service credential for the internal FormatForge API expired and nobody got the calendar reminder. I've regenerated it and re-ran the batch — all locales now render correctly, including the tricky Velmsk ordering. For anyone who needs to run it locally, the fresh key is below.

gateway credential: qvz3-qsf

Runbook 4.2 — Inter-office contract transfers. Signed contracts moving between the Ashgrove and Ferndale offices travel in tamper-evident envelopes only, never loose folders. The office manager logs each envelope number before release and confirms receipt with the far end by close of business. Collections are handled exclusively by Redwick Courier Services under the standing agreement. The confidential hand-over instruction for the courier is set out immediately below.

courier memo of tawep-tajep: the quenius ulaiel courier leaves the fenir ledger at gate 9128 under passcode 527513